Bowl America, Inc. engages in the operation of bowling centers, with food and beverage service in each center. The company is headquartered in Alexandria, Virginia and currently employs 250 full-time employees. The firm is engaged in the operation of bowling centers, with food and beverage service in each center. As of July 3, 2016, the Company and its subsidiaries operated 18 bowling centers, including 10 centers located in metropolitan Washington, District of Columbia; one center in metropolitan Baltimore, Maryland; four centers in metropolitan Richmond, Virginia, and three centers in metropolitan Jacksonville, Florida. As of July 3, 2016, the 18 centers contained a total of 726 lanes. The firm's bowling centers are air-conditioned with facilities for service of food and beverages, game rooms, rental lockers and meeting room facilities. Its bowling centers provide shoes for rental, and it also provides bowling balls. In addition, each center sells retail bowling accessories. Its bowling centers also offer glow-in-the-dark bowling and non-league bowling. The company offers bowling centers for kids, companies and adults.
